CMC-Na/浒苔水提物复合膜的特性及保鲜效果研究
Study on properties and preservation effect of CMC-Na/water extract of enteromorpha prolifera composite film
摘要
Abstract
To enhance the performance of sodium carboxymethyl cellulose(CMC-Na)films,composite films were prepared using CMC-Na as the film-forming matrix,Water extract of enteromorpha prolifera and sorbitol as functional components.Single-factor experiments combined with response surface methodology optimized the composite ratio.Mechanical strength,barrier properties(water vapor and oxygen permeability),and microstructure(SEM,XRD)of the films were analyzed,followed by preservation tests on plum fruits.Results showed the optimal composition:CMC-Na 2.726 g/(100 mL),Water extract of enteromorpha prolifera 0.523 g/(100 mL),sorbitol 0.386 g/(100 mL).The film exhibited tensile strength of 31.09 MPa,water vapor permeability of 2.55×10⁻¹2 g/(m⋅s⋅Pa),and oxygen permeability of 5.19×10⁻⁷ g/(m⋅s).Preservation tests indicated that,with day 0 hardness as baseline(100%),the coated group maintained 57.1%hardness retention on day 4,significantly higher than the CK group(14.8%).On day 10,soluble solids content of the treated group(1.30%)exceeded CK group(0.933 33%)by 39.3%;titratable acid reduction was 26.1%(vs.37.8%in CK group).From day 0 to 10,malondialdehyde content in treated group was 24.8%~55.9%lower than CK group.This study provides theoretical support for high-value utilization of algal resources.关键词
